服务器负载均衡部署模式指的是通过特定算法和策略,将网络请求分散到多台服务器上,以优化资源分配、提高系统处理能力和可靠性的技术。本文深入探讨了负载均衡的原理,详细解析了不同部署模式及其应用策略,旨在提高系统性能与用户体验。
本文目录导读:
服务器负载均衡部署模式是一种高效的网络架构设计,旨在通过合理分配请求,优化服务器资源的使用,提高系统的整体性能和可靠性,本文将从服务器负载均衡部署模式的定义、工作原理、常见部署模式及其应用策略等方面进行详细解析。
服务器负载均衡部署模式的定义
服务器负载均衡部署模式,就是通过一种或多种技术手段,将用户请求合理地分配到一组服务器上,使每台服务器都能高效地处理请求,避免单台服务器过载,这种部署模式能够提高系统的可用性、可扩展性和性能。
服务器负载均衡部署模式的工作原理
服务器负载均衡部署模式的工作原理主要基于以下三个方面:
1、请求分发:负载均衡器接收到用户请求后,根据预设的分配策略,将请求分发到不同的服务器上。
图片来源于网络,如有侵权联系删除
2、响应整合:服务器处理请求后,将响应结果返回给负载均衡器,负载均衡器再将结果整合后返回给用户。
3、负载均衡策略:负载均衡器根据服务器资源使用情况、响应时间等参数,动态调整请求分配策略,确保服务器资源得到合理利用。
常见服务器负载均衡部署模式
1、轮询模式:将请求按照时间顺序依次分配到服务器上,每台服务器处理完一个请求后,再分配下一个请求,这种模式简单易实现,但可能造成服务器负载不均衡。
2、加权轮询模式:在轮询模式的基础上,为每台服务器设置一个权重,根据权重分配请求,权重高的服务器处理更多的请求,权重低的服务器处理较少的请求,这种模式能够更好地平衡服务器负载。
3、最少连接模式:将请求分配给连接数最少的服务器,以降低服务器的连接压力,这种模式适用于处理长连接请求的场景。
图片来源于网络,如有侵权联系删除
4、加权最少连接模式:在最少连接模式的基础上,为每台服务器设置一个权重,根据权重和连接数分配请求,这种模式能够在保证连接数最少的同时,考虑服务器性能差异。
5、基于内容分发模式:根据请求内容的不同,将请求分发到不同的服务器,静态资源请求分发到专门处理静态资源的服务器,动态资源请求分发到专门处理动态资源的服务器。
服务器负载均衡部署模式的应用策略
1、选择合适的负载均衡算法:根据业务需求和服务器性能,选择合适的负载均衡算法,确保服务器资源得到合理利用。
2、监控服务器状态:实时监控服务器资源使用情况、响应时间等参数,以便动态调整负载均衡策略。
3、高可用性设计:通过冗余部署负载均衡器,确保系统在高负载情况下仍然能够正常运行。
图片来源于网络,如有侵权联系删除
4、弹性伸缩:根据业务需求,动态调整服务器数量,实现系统性能的弹性伸缩。
5、安全防护:通过负载均衡器对请求进行过滤和防护,提高系统的安全性。
服务器负载均衡部署模式是一种有效的网络架构设计,能够提高系统的性能、可用性和可靠性,在实际应用中,应根据业务需求和服务器性能,选择合适的负载均衡算法和部署策略,以实现最优的系统性能。
评论列表